Output 905f71a80fb3662017741bd6728987d294184b14fbe19a5ac55f6e39cbeebfc5:0

value
3058405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c490d52141646027917f97cb94e49cbb576793f OP_EQUAL
address
3Mmn6VR4ocjZ6TLNHJUBVVQ8gpV1TRTN8x
transaction
905f71a80fb3662017741bd6728987d294184b14fbe19a5ac55f6e39cbeebfc5
spent
true